ATLANTA & NEW YORK--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Intercontinental Exchange (NYSE: ICE), the leading global network of exchanges and clearing houses, today reported financial results for the second quarter of 2015. For the quarter ended June 30, 2015, consolidated net income attributable to ICE was $283 million on $797 million of consolidated revenues less transaction-based expenses.
